U.S. Envoy to Syria Tom Barrack has a clear message for the US-backed Syrian Democratic Forces (SDF).
“So there’s a big sentiment that because they were our partners, we owe them. The question is what do we owe them? We don’t owe them the ability to have their own independent government within a government,” he said on Friday.
Barrack’s latest comments come as part of a greater context which is that the policy of the United States is to have a single Syria and a single army and not to support federalism.
